The annual salary statistics of taxi drivers and chauffeurs in Naples-Marco Island, Florida is shown in Table 1. The wage data of taxi drivers and chauffeurs in Naples-Marco Island is based on the national compensation survey conducted by the U.S. Bureau of Labor Statistics in 2022 and published in April 2023 [1].
Percentile Bracket | Average Annual Salary |
---|---|
10th Percentile Wage | $20,800 |
25th Percentile Wage | $23,520 |
50th Percentile Wage | $32,310 |
75th Percentile Wage | $39,550 |
90th Percentile Wage | $48,300 |
Table 1 shows the average annual salary for taxi drivers and chauffeurs in Naples-Marco Island, Florida in 5 percentile scales. The average annual salary for the 90th percentile (the top 10 percent of the highest paid) is $48,300. The median (50th percentile) annual salary is $32,310. The average annual salary for the bottom 10 percent earners is $20,800.
The table and chart below show the trend of the median salary of taxi drivers and chauffeurs from 2012 to 2018.
Year | Median Salary | Yearly Growth | 6-Year Growth |
---|---|---|---|
2018 | $32,310 | 11.76% | 24.45% |
2017 | $28,510 | 9.75% | - |
2016 | $25,730 | 5.83% | - |
2015 | $24,230 | 0.50% | - |
2014 | $24,110 | 1.41% | - |
2013 | $23,770 | -2.69% | - |
2012 | $24,410 | - | - |
